Specific Gravity Calculator & Engineering Guide - AluCalc
Ratio of the density of a substance to the density of water at 4°C.
Mathematical Definition
SG = \frac{\rho_{substance}}{\rho_{water}}
rho_sub=Substance density
rho_water=Reference density
